Receive update on SPRAWLDEF lawsuit appeal in federal court
In Plain English
The city attorney will brief the council on a lawsuit filed by SPRAWLDEF that is currently before the Ninth Circuit Court of Appeals. SPRAWLDEF is a group that opposes urban sprawl development. The case involves the city as defendant, meaning SPRAWLDEF is suing Richmond over some decision or policy.

Adopt formal statement condemning online criticism of city manager
In Plain English
Someone posted critical comments about the city manager's job performance on an online forum. The city council wants to formally disapprove of these statements. If approved, the city takes an official position defending the city manager against public criticism.
